I think Chess is a great game! It forces the player to think... Actually use their mind and make a decision.

Computer games are very fast paced, spur of the moment... No time to think, just keep clicking!

I agree that kids today need to "get outside' and run around, because any type of exercise is better than becoming "couch potatoes", but I think chess can still be a very fun part of their lives.

It's probably not for every kid, just as playing a musical instrument is not for everyone. But, for many, it can become quite an addictive sport (for the mind, that is).

Remember back in the day when the most popular game was checkers? Milton Bradley still sells plenty of 'Checkers' games today! Board games have been around for a very long time, and hopefully they won't become forgotten, but will remain a popular past time!
